Miltenberg
Miltenberg, a beautiful town in Lower Franconia, Bavaria, tempts visitors with its unique charm and a historic old town that is among the best-preserved half-timbered towns in Germany. The town is idyllically situated on the banks of the Main River, framed by the gentle hills of the Odenwald and Spessart, making it an ideal destination for a convertible tour in Bavaria. The combination of medieval architecture, half-timbered houses, and modern attractions draws countless tourists every year.
The Best Attractions in Miltenberg
The town has much to offer. Among the most famous attractions is the Hotel Zum Riesen, one of the oldest taverns in Germany. In operation since the 16th century, it still serves as a traditional inn today. Another highlight is the Mildenburg, an impressive castle that was once the residence of the administrative officials of the Archdiocese of Mainz. Today, it houses a museum that showcases icons and contemporary art. The City Museum of Miltenberg offers interesting exhibitions on the history of the town, including artifacts from Roman times.
Another must-see for history enthusiasts is the Old Synagogue, a gem of Jewish architecture from the 13th century. It is one of the oldest Jewish sacred buildings in Germany and provides insight into Jewish life and the history of the region. The Laurentius Chapel is another cultural highlight, impressing visitors with its medieval frescoes and ornate wing altar.
Convertible Tours and Nature Experiences
Miltenberg and its surroundings offer numerous opportunities for an unforgettable convertible tour. A particularly recommended drive follows the Main River, leading from Miltenberg through small villages, vineyards, and fortifications. The route provides breathtaking views of the river and the surrounding nature. Travelers can enjoy the picturesque landscape of the Odenwald and stop in small wine towns to discover the local Franconian wine culture.
For those wanting to further explore the Spessart or the Odenwald, another exciting convertible route can be taken from Miltenberg through the nature park, offering numerous opportunities for travelers to discover the region in their own way.
Miltenberg is also located on the fabulous Nibelungenstraße and is part of the German Half-Timbered Route.
Accommodation and Dining in Miltenberg
Miltenberg also has a lot to offer in terms of accommodation and dining. From cozy half-timbered hotels to modern accommodations, visitors will find just the right place here. The local gastronomy is characterized by traditional Franconian dishes served in the town's inns and restaurants. Particularly recommended are regional specialties such as Schäufele, bratwurst, and the famous Miltenberg wine.
